I'm in the process of sorting through my clutter. Clothes are mostly done, photos and writing stored away, G has been tackling the cupboards. I'm leaving my books till last. I have boxes of books in my study (about 500 unread), I find it really hard to part with a book I haven't read and I'm having to be very stern with myself. At least I have them sorted into categories now - to be read, to wild release and to give to charity. Only thing is, I have had them in categories for almost two years and still they remain.

It's true that clearing away clutter helps make things simpler. Not only because you have more room and can easily find things but also I find it helps clear my head. Every time I walk into my room and see the books, it reminds me of a job unfinished. Tidying things away gives the mind time to think of more important things.
